Definitions of balloon word

  • countable noun balloon A balloon is a small, thin, rubber bag that you blow air into so that it becomes larger and rounder or longer. Balloons are used as toys or decorations. 3
  • countable noun balloon A balloon is a large, strong bag filled with gas or hot air, which can carry passengers in a container that hangs underneath it. 3
  • verb balloon When something balloons, it increases rapidly in amount. 3
  • noun balloon an inflatable rubber bag of various sizes, shapes, and colours: usually used as a plaything or party decoration 3
  • noun balloon a large impermeable bag inflated with a lighter-than-air gas, designed to rise and float in the atmosphere. It may have a basket or gondola for carrying passengers, etc 3
  • noun balloon a circular or elliptical figure containing the words or thoughts of a character in a cartoon 3

Origin of balloon

First appearance:

before 1570
One of the 33% oldest English words
1570-80; < Upper Italian ballone, equivalent to ball(a) (< Langobardic; see ball1) + -one augmentative suffix; or < Middle French ballon < Upper Italian
